History

The league was created in 2003 on the premise that local teams should have local players. The existing senior league at the time, the Hanover-Taché Hockey League (HTHL), included a large number of imported players. During its first season, the CSHL was operated as an independent league and did not have accreditation from Hockey Manitoba. Three teams competed that season (Landmark Dutchmen,
Mitchell Mohawks The Mitchell Mohawks were a Canadian junior 'C' ice hockey team based in Mitchell, Manitoba until 2019. A senior team with the same name also competed in the Carillon Senior Hockey League until 2013. The minor hockey organization (U7-U18) change ...
, Ste. Anne Aces) with Mitchell winning the championship. In its second season, the CSHL was accepted by
Hockey Manitoba Hockey Manitoba is the governing body of amateur ice hockey in the province of Manitoba, Canada. Hockey Manitoba was founded in 1914 as the ''Manitoba Amateur Hockey Association'' and is a branch affiliate of Hockey Canada. As part of its mandat ...
. The league doubled to six teams, with the Grunthal Red Wings, St. Adolphe Hawks and
Steinbach Huskies The Steinbach Huskies are a junior and senior ice hockey club based in Steinbach, Manitoba, Canada. Senior Huskies Founded in the 1920s, the Senior Huskies have played in several leagues over the years: the Hanover-Tache Hockey League (1953–2 ...
being accepted. Mitchell once again won the championship. Prior to the third season, the rival HTHL folded, and two teams joined the CSHL: the La Broquerie Habs and St. Malo Warriors. This brought the league total of teams to eight. The La Broquerie Habs defeated the Ste Anne Aces in four-straight games to claim the league championship. In its fourth season, the Steinbach Huskies went on hiatus while the Landmark Dutchmen folded, leaving the league with six teams yet again. The La Broquerie Habs defeated Ste. Anne in five games to claim their second straight league title. In provincial competition, the La Broquerie Habs won the Manitoba Senior 'A' provincial championship. The Steinbach Huskies rejoined the league for the 2007-08 season, while Grunthal Red Wings went on hiatus. This season produced a new champion, the Ste. Anne Aces, who defeated St. Malo in seven games to become the champions. The following season, it was the St. Malo Warriors that ended a 21-year championship drought and captured their first CSHL title. The final was a rather quick series as St. Malo won in five games, winning the cup at home against the Ste. Anne Aces. The 2008-09 season was a special year for hockey in St. Malo as both the Senior Warriors and the Junior 'B' Warriors of the
Keystone Junior Hockey League The Keystone Junior Hockey League (KJHL) is a Junior 'B' ice hockey league in the province of Manitoba, Canada. The league, sanctioned by Hockey Manitoba, was formerly known as the Manitoba Junior 'B' Hockey League. History The KJHL champion us ...
captured their respective titles in the same year for the first time in the town's history. In 2009-10 season, the Steinbach Huskies won both the CSHL championship and the Manitoba Provincial 'A' Championship. The Huskies followed up their provincial championship by defeating La Broqerie in the seventh game of the finals the following day. Captain Mike Martens scored with 3:13 left in the third period to clinch the victory. The championship was a first for the Steinbach team in the CSHL, and the first local league title since the Huskies won the Hanover-Tache Hockey League in 1993-94. The Huskies repeated as champions the following season. In only their second season in the CSHL, the Niverville Clippers captured their first league title in 2012, sweeping La Broquerie in four games.

Champions

Each season, the winner of the playoffs is crowned league champion. The CHSL champion compete against Manitoba's other senior league champions for the Manitoba Senior 'A' Provincial Championship.
